Qwen, as a large pre-trained model introduced by Alibaba Cloud, not only has powerful natural language processing capabilities, but is also able to perform a variety of tasks such as multimodal understanding and code generation.

In a landmark move for China’s artificial intelligence sector, Alibaba’s Qwen team and Manus AI announced a strategic partnership to accelerate AI integration across domestic platforms. This collaboration combines Qwen’s powerful open-source language models with Manus’ autonomous agent capabilities, creating a localized solution poised to transform enterprise AI adoption in China.

Challenges and Opportunities

While promising, the partnership faces:

  • Regulatory compliance across provinces
  • Hardware optimization for domestic GPUs
  • Enterprise adoption inertia

The Alibaba Qwen-Manus AI partnership represents a significant leap in China’s AI development, combining technical prowess with market-specific adaptation. As enterprises prepare for AI integration strategies, this collaboration offers a blueprint for Chinese innovation meeting global standards.
